Grasmere Road is a residential street with 30 addresses.
It ranks as the 300th largest and 353rd most expensive of the 474 streets in the CH65 area. The dominant property type is a mid-century house built between 1936 and 1979.
The street contains a total of 30 properties: 30 houses.

Sale prices range from £203,392 for 3 bedroom leasehold houses with a garden (731 ft2) to £310,562 for 4 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(1,657 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£870 pcm for 3 bed houses to £1,019 pcm for 4 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 3.9% and 5.1%.
The average value per square foot is £246.
The last sale on Grasmere Road sold for £210,000 on 19th April 2024. Since then prices are up an average of 5.8%.
The current average value in the street is £225,995.
The Grasmere Road Sales Market has increased by 47.8% over the last 10 years.

The last sale was on 19th April 2024 for £210,000 and since then the market in the area has increased by 5.8%. The street has had a total of 17 sales since 1995.
Grasmere Road, Ellesmere Port, CH65 has seen 1 sale in the last three years and no sales in the last twelve months.
Grasmere Road, Ellesmere Port, CH65 is the 300th largest and the 353rd most expensive street in the CH65 area.
There are 2 postcodes on Grasmere Road, Ellesmere Port, CH65.
The closest station to Grasmere Road, Ellesmere Port, CH65 is Ellesmere Port station which is 1.6 kilometres away.
